Duration : The duration is the number of microseconds that the current enters the skin for during each pulse. TENS is a noninvasive method for relieving pain. People who experience pain relief from TENS may be able to reduce their intake of pain medications, some of which can be addictive or cause adverse side effects.

TENS units are also convenient because they are small, portable, and relatively discrete. People can carry a TENS unit in their pocket or clip it onto a belt to ensure that they have immediate access to pain relief throughout the day. It is safe for most people to use a TENS unit, and they will not usually experience any side effects.

However, the electrical impulses that a TENS unit produces may cause a buzzing, tingling, or prickling sensation, which some people may find uncomfortable. Some people may be allergic to the adhesive pads. Anyone who experiences skin redness and irritation can switch to using hypoallergenic ones instead. It is vital never to place the electrodes on either the front of the neck or the eyes. Putting electrodes on the neck can lower blood pressure and cause spasms.

On the eyes, the electrodes can increase pressure within the eye and possibly cause an injury. Although it is safe for most people, experts recommend that some groups of people avoid TENS treatment unless a doctor advises its use.

Due to a lack of high-quality research and clinical trials, researchers have not yet determined whether TENS is a reliable treatment for pain relief. One study found that TENS treatment provided temporary pain relief for people with fibromyalgia while the machine was in use.

While there is a lack of strong clinical evidence for its effectiveness, TENS is a low-risk pain relief option for many people. Research shows that people who use a TENS unit on a daily basis at the same frequency and intensity can develop a tolerance to the treatment.

A person who develops tolerance will no longer feel the same level of pain relief that they did when they first used the unit. The range of intensities of the electrical stimulation may account for some of the differences in research findings.

TENS may be more effective if people place the electrodes on acupuncture points. Acupuncture is a practice that uses needles to stimulate the nerves beneath the skin at specific locations known as acupuncture points. Experts believe that this assists the body in producing endorphins. E-stim therapy for muscle recovery sends signals to targeted muscles to make them contract. Flexing your biceps is a form of muscle contraction. By causing repeated muscle contractions, blood flow improves, helping repair injured muscles.

Those muscles also improve their strength through repeated cycles of contraction and relaxation. This is an especially helpful benefit for stroke survivors who must essentially relearn basic motor functions. The type of e-stim that focuses on pain relief sends signals on a different wavelength so they reach the nerves, rather than the muscles. Electrical stimulation can block pain receptors from being sent from nerves to the brain. TENS may be used for chronic long-term pain as well as for acute short-term pain.

Electrodes are placed on the skin near the source of the pain. Signals are sent through nerve fibers to block or at least reduce the pain signals traveling to the brain. This can improve muscle strength if the user attempts to contract the muscle simultaneously.

As part of a physical therapy program, you may be provided a battery-powered unit to use at home. E-stim uses small electrodes placed on the skin. The electrodes are small, sticky pads that should come off with little discomfort at the end of the session. Several electrodes are placed around the area receiving treatment. Wires from the e-stim device are attached to the pads.

Steady streams of electrical pulses are delivered through the wires from the e-stim unit. The unit may be small enough to fit in your hand or larger, like a landline phone and answering machine. Pulses aimed at the nervous system block the transmission of pain signals from reaching the spinal cord and brain. The pulses also stimulate the body to produce more natural pain-relieving chemicals called endorphins.
